Dirig\u00e9 par eDNAtec Inc., de concert avec ses partenaires Energy Research &amp; Innovation Newfoundland &amp; Labrador, Nunavut Fisheries Association et P\u00eaches et Oc\u00e9ans Canada, le syst\u00e8me OceanDNA r\u00e9volutionnera la fa\u00e7on d\u2019\u00e9valuer, de surveiller et de caract\u00e9riser l\u2019oc\u00e9an.<\/p>\n<p>De la valeur totale du projet de 4,9 millions de dollars, Supergrappe des oc\u00e9ans fournira un financement de 2,2 millions de dollars pour compl\u00e9ter le solde du financement provenant de partenaires de l\u2019industrie. Dix-sept emplois appuieront directement les activit\u00e9s de recherche et d\u00e9veloppement reli\u00e9s au syst\u00e8me OceanDNA. De plus, des \u00e9tudiants ayant obtenu un dipl\u00f4me universitaire auront \u00e9galement l\u2019occasion de s\u2019impliquer dans le projet pour leur permettre d\u2019acqu\u00e9rir des comp\u00e9tences et de l\u2019exp\u00e9rience dans ce domaine.<\/p>\n<p>Le syst\u00e8me OceanDNA offre des applications \u00e0 travers des secteurs oc\u00e9aniques et il pourrait \u00eatre utilis\u00e9 pour faciliter la gestion durable des oc\u00e9ans et des activit\u00e9s connexes. En lisant l\u2019ADN d\u2019\u00e9chantillons environnementaux, tels que les s\u00e9diments ou l\u2019eau de mer, on peut identifier une vaste gamme d\u2019organismes \u00e0 partir de bact\u00e9ries jusqu\u2019aux mammif\u00e8res marins. Cela donne alors une image compl\u00e8te de l\u2019\u00e9cosyst\u00e8me. La technologie eDNAtec r\u00e9alise des r\u00e9ductions de co\u00fbts \u00e9prouv\u00e9s, renforce la g\u00e9rance de l\u2019environnement, rehausse la s\u00e9curit\u00e9 et prend en charge la conformit\u00e9 r\u00e9glementaire.<\/p>\n<p>L\u2019activit\u00e9 du projet sera dirig\u00e9e \u00e0 partir du Centre for Environmental Genomics Applications (CEGA) d\u2019eDNAtec \u00e0 St. John\u2019s \u00e0 Terre-Neuve-et-Labrador en collaboration avec des partenaires du projet en vue de d\u00e9velopper et de commercialiser des solutions g\u00e9nomiques pour moderniser la fa\u00e7on dont nous surveillons, mesurons et \u00e9valuons les stocks de poissons. Les donn\u00e9es d\u2019ADN de l\u2019environnement peuvent \u00e9galement \u00eatre combin\u00e9es \u00e0 des donn\u00e9es compl\u00e9mentaires provenant de l\u2019acoustique, la t\u00e9l\u00e9d\u00e9tection, les d\u00e9nombrements par des activit\u00e9s de p\u00eache ainsi que la connaissance historique pour g\u00e9n\u00e9rer des mod\u00e8les pr\u00e9dictifs de la pr\u00e9sence, l\u2019emplacement et l\u2019abondance des esp\u00e8ces cibles de grande valeur.<\/p>\n<p>Les approches conventionnelles pour l\u2019\u00e9valuation \u00e9cologique, tels que l\u2019\u00e9chantillonnage direct et l\u2019observation visuelle\/acoustique, sont co\u00fbteuses et souvent impr\u00e9cises. L\u2019\u00e9chantillonnage \u00ab capture et observation \u00bb, le tri et l\u2019identification individuelle des organismes sont fastidieux et exigeants en main-d\u2019\u0153uvre. Il est aussi parfois nocif ou perturbateur pour des esp\u00e8ces rares ou en danger de disparition.
